17 June 2024
Museum of History and the Future, Turku, southwest Finland
Design: Sigge Architects

image courtesy of architects practice
Selected from over 400 entries, leading Finnish architecture practice Sigge Architects has designed the winning scheme for the world’s first Museum of History and the Future in Turku, Finland. This architecture competition for the new museum, which is set to be completed in 2029 and is located in the city’s harbour, attracted over 400 entries from across the globe.

28 Oct 2022
Finnish Design Shop, Turku – Nordic design store
Design: avanto architects ltd

photo : kuvio.com / Anders Portman
Finnish Design Shop is the world’s largest online store of Nordic design. The company’s fast growth accelerated during the pandemic, as physical stores needed to close their doors. The new building, headquarters of the company, comprises a logistics center delivering products to over one hundred countries, a showroom, and a restaurant.

15 Apr 2022
Arctic TreeHouse Hotel Restaurant Rovaniemi
Design: Studio Puisto Architects

photo : Marc Goodwin
The building stands on a steep hillside and appears to merge with the surrounding nature. It turns its back on the slope and stretches out into the landscape with its fingers. The vegetation between the fingers grows close to the building, forcing it to engage in a dialogue with the surrounding Arctic environment.

Sweco acquires Finnish architecture company Linja Arkkitehdit
Sweco has signed an agreement to acquire Linja Arkkitehdit Oy, specialised in design of educational and business premises as well as residential buildings. With the acquisition Sweco becomes one of the largest architecture companies in Finland.
Linja Arkkitehdit Oy has approximately 60 architects located in Oulu, Helsinki and Jyväskylä. The company offers architectural services in the design of educational establishments, residential premises and business premises. The revenue of Linja Arkkitehdit during 2020 was EUR 5.3 million.
“This acquisition is fully in line with our history and strategy to be able to provide integrated architecture and technical consultancy services to our clients. I am pleased that we are strengthening our architectural offering in Finland,” says Åsa Bergman, President and CEO of Sweco.
“Sweco and Linja Arkkitehdit have already successfully cooperated in several projects over the years, and now we are able to deepen the cooperation even further. The acquisition strengthens our client relationships through our ability to offer them a broader set of services and expertise together,” says Markku Varis, President of Sweco Finland.
“I am very pleased that Linja Arkkitehdit has found a home to grow together with Sweco. Sweco’s expertise and position is highly recognised in the industry, and Sweco is already a familiar and reliable partner for us. We have had a successful cooperation in many projects and our services complement each other,” says Ville Niskasaari, CEO of Linja Arkkitehdit Oy.
Through the acquisition, Sweco will have 120 architects in the Finnish market, including those joining Sweco through the acquisition of Optiplan in January 2021. In total, Sweco Group has around 1,400 architects and landscape architects and is one of the world’s five largest architecture firms.
